In Situ Lung Dust Analysis by Automated Field Emission Scanning Electron Microscopy With Energy Dispersive X-ray Spectroscopy: A Method for Assessing Inorganic Particles in Lung Tissue From Coal Miners.
Emily SarverCigdem KelesHeather LowersLauren Zell-BaranLeonard GoJeremy HuaCarlyne CoolCecile RoseFrancis GreenKirsten AlmbergRobert CohenPublished in: Archives of pathology & laboratory medicine (2024)
Automated FESEM-EDS analysis of lung dust is feasible in situ and could be applied to a larger set of mineral dust-exposed lung tissues to investigate specific histologic features of PMF and other dust-related occupational diseases.
